Khodzheilin Formation

Khodzheilin Fm


Period: 
Cretaceous

Age Interval: 
lower-middle Aptian, U2


Province: 
Ustyurt-Sultanuzdag

Type Locality and Naming

Along the village of Khodzheili, S. Pre-Aral. I.M. Abdurazimov in 1996. Wells. Stratotype - section of the profile well 1 of the village of Hodzheili.

Synonym: Khodzheilinskaya Suite, Ходжеклинская св.


Lithology and Thickness

Gray, greenish-gray sandstones, clays with layers of siltstone (aleurolites), with phosphorite and glauconite. Thickness 40-200m.

Relationships and Distribution

Lower contact

Overlies conformably on the Chimbay Fm

Upper contact

It is overlain transgressively by the Sultanbobin Fm.

Fossils

Contains marine bivalve mollusks Amphidonte vulgata Vinok., Cymbula gardneri (J. Nikit.); foraminifers Mjatliukaena gaultina (Berth.), Haplophragmoides aff. nonioninoides (Reuss.); complex of spores and pollen - Gleicheniidites carinatus Bolch. (0-1), G. senonicus Ross. (1535), Clavifera tuberosa Bolch. (0-1), C. triplex Bolch. (0-1), Pilosisporites setiferus (Verb.) Shv. (0-1), Inaperturopollenites Dubius (Pot. et Ven.) Tn. et Ph. (17-36).


Age 

Conditionally belongs to the lower + middle Aptian. Used in the legend of the Pre-Aral subseries to geological maps of the 1:200000, 1998 scale.
